It's been a hard slog today, first part I thought was gonna be downhill all the way until I saw the rivers flowing towards us.
It was an uphill struggle to Mont Louis with an altitude asthmatic bike, stopped and wandered into the garrison to have a look around and take some pics then was kicked out by a mean looking fella "zone militaire" he said..

It was another 12km freewheel down to Villefranche de Conflent for lunch and then off to find fuel.

Then to Perpignan, Beziers and Sete on the way to Aigues Mortes where we have found a nice little hotel, a cold shower was welcome after the 30deg heat.

Later we'll hit the town for summat to eat.
